Calabrian Chile + Preserved Lemon Zucchini (Skillet)

Credit: Samin Nosrat, Good Things

Overview

A bold, bright zucchini side with Calabrian chile heat, preserved lemon tang, and a glossy olive oil finish. Simple ingredients, high flavor.

Total Time

30 minutes

Yield

4 servings

Ingredients

  • 1 Tbsp. Calabrian chile paste

  • 1 Tbsp. preserved lemon paste or finely chopped preserved lemon

  • 2 tsp. pure maple syrup

  • 5 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il, divided

  • 1½ lb. slender zucchini (about 3 medium), ends trimmed, cut into ¾"-thick rounds

  • Kosher salt

  • Mixed tender herb leaves with tender stems (such as parsley and/or basil; for serving)

Instructions

Step 1

Whisk 1 Tbsp. Calabrian chile paste, 1 Tbsp. preserved lemon paste or finely chopped preserved lemon, 2 tsp. pure maple syrup, and 2 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il in a medium bowl to combine. Set dressing aside.

Step 2

Pour remaining 3 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il into a large cast-iron skillet. Working in 2 batches if needed, arrange 1½ lb. slender zucchini (about 3 medium), ends trimmed, cut into ¾"-thick rounds, cut sides down, in a single layer in skillet. Place over medium-high heat and cook, undisturbed, until deep golden brown underneath, 7–9 minutes (be careful as oil will spatter). Turn and cook until golden brown on other side, about 5 minutes. Transfer to bowl with reserved dressing and toss to coat; season with kosher salt. Arrange on a platter; top with mixed tender herb leaves with tender stems (such as parsley and/or basil).
